We present an alternative technique to enhance the discrimination performance in a JTC architecture, employed as a validation procedure. We define as complex objects those amplitude objects bonded to random phase masks. When using complex objects as reference inputs in a JTC optical validation system, correlation peak intensity and correlation peak shape become simultaneous key parameters to increase the discrimination ability of the system. Simulation results, comparing amplitude-only objects versus complex objects as inputs to the system, reveal the validity of our approach and show the sensitivity of the JTC architecture to the additional phase structures.
